Elk Rapids Real Estate / Direct Answer
Elk Rapids is a historic coastal village in Antrim County, Michigan, located 17 miles (approx. 20 minutes) north of Traverse City along US-31. Situated at the confluence of the Elk River and Grand Traverse Bay, Elk Rapids offers dual water access to open Great Lakes waters and the 75-mile Antrim County Chain of Lakes (including Elk Lake and Torch Lake). Home options include deep-water marina condos, historic village homes, and luxury waterfront estates ranging from $350,000 to $1.5 million+.

Elk Rapids stands out among Northern Michigan coastal communities by offering dual water access, an active downtown village, and small-class public schooling.
Elk Rapids Marina serves as the community center, providing deep-water slips on Grand Traverse Bay. The walkable downtown along River Street features historic brick architecture, local boutiques, Cellar 152 wine bar, and Pearl's New Orleans Kitchen.
Positioned at the mouth of the Elk River, residents can navigate 75 miles of connected inland waterways across 12 lakes, including Elk Lake, Skegemog Lake, and Torch Lake, without needing to portage.
Supported by the independent Elk Rapids Schools K-12 district, the village maintains a close-knit atmosphere celebrated during the annual summer Harbor Days festival on public bay beaches.

Where is Elk Rapids, Michigan located?
Elk Rapids is a village in Antrim County, Michigan, situated 17 miles north of Traverse City along US-31. It lies at the mouth of the Elk River where it empties into Grand Traverse Bay.
What is the Chain of Lakes near Elk Rapids?
The Antrim County Chain of Lakes is a 75-mile connected waterway system of 12 lakes, starting at the Elk River in Elk Rapids and connecting through Elk Lake, Torch Lake, Clam Lake, and Lake Skegemog.
How far is Elk Rapids from Traverse City?
Elk Rapids is approximately 17 miles north of downtown Traverse City via highway US-31, providing a convenient 20-minute commute to Cherry Capital Airport (TVC) and Munson Medical Center.
What public school district serves Elk Rapids?
Elk Rapids is served by its own independent K-12 public school district, Elk Rapids Schools, headquarters in the village.
